Many signage projects begin too late, or focus only on fabrication. Zest starts with the property, the visitor journey and the brand experience.
We map how people arrive, explore, identify and use a space, then design the right signage for each stage. This helps reduce confusion, improve navigation and create a more premium impression for offices, hotels, residences, schools, retail spaces and commercial environments.
For large-scale signage design and build in Thailand, we agree the design, fabrication and installation responsibilities at the start. Zest coordinates specialist production and installation partners within the agreed scope, with material approvals and site access planned alongside the property team.
We map arrival routes, entrances, circulation, decision points and destinations, then organise sign locations and information into a coherent system.
We design entrance and logo signs, directories, directional signs, room identifiers and operational signs with consistent information hierarchy and visual language.
Sign schedules, production artwork and technical details connect the approved design to fabrication. Materials, finishes, fixing methods and lighting requirements are reviewed for the location.
We coordinate specialist partners, samples and approvals, installation access and on-site checks within the agreed project scope.
For residential and mixed-use projects, we plan the relationship between development identity, building entrances, parking, lift lobbies, floors, units and shared facilities.
We adapt the system to guest journeys, tenant and visitor needs, bilingual information and the character of the property. Environmental graphics can extend the same identity across walls and shared spaces.
Review plans, site conditions, visitor routes and sign requirements with the property team.
Agree sign families, hierarchy, materials and the visual relationship to the brand.
Develop artwork and details, coordinate samples and confirm approvals with production partners.
Plan site access, installation sequencing and agreed quality checks with the delivery team.
Yes. Zest provides signage design and can coordinate production and installation through specialist partners. The proposal sets out the responsibilities, approval stages and site requirements for your project.
Yes. Share the masterplan, building and floor layouts, brand guidelines and phasing. We can plan a consistent sign system across entrances, parking, circulation and residential facilities.
The sign quantity, dimensions, location, finish, illumination, fixing requirements and installation access affect the specification and cost. We review these before confirming a production scope and schedule.
